London: Adam and Charles Black, 1912. Cloth. Very Good. 9" by 6.5". Mortimer Menpes. A beautifully illustrated topographical guide to Brittany, in the smart original cloth binding. This work is one of a larger series produced by A and C Black, which saw many decoratively bound and profusely illustrated topographical works on various countries. Menpes went on a sketching tour of Brittany in 1880 and this work contains several sketches from this journey. Illustrated throughout by Mortimer Menpes with the text written by his daughter Dorothy. With seventy-five colour illustrations. Mortimer Menpes was an Australian-born artist, author, printmaker and illustrator. This work is a reprint published seven years after the work's initial publication. A smart example of this comprehensive guide which takes the reader on a journey around many parts of Brittany, discussing its history and culture. In the publisher's original cloth binding.
